School No.1 (Alekseyevka)

Russia / Belgorod / Alekseyevka / ulitsa Remeslennikov, 6

Municipal educational institution Secondary school No.1 of Alexeyevka town of Belgorod region.

The school started functioning in 1915 as men’s gymnasium — the first and only in Alekseyevsky district.
From 1934 year the school was functioned as unified labor secondary school.
During the Great Patriotic War (1941 — 1945) 60 teachers and graduates of the school have not returned from the front. Three of them — Nicholay Ruban, Vasily Sobina and Matvey Shaposhnikov were awarded of the title of the Hero of the Soviet Union.
The math classes were created in school in 1950-s for the first time and operate until the present time.
Since 1967 year the school is located in newly-built model building.
In 2016 year the school building was refurnished.
Over the years 10 graduates of the school became doctors of science, 40 have protected master's theses, 280 graduates were awarded by gold and silver medals.
The Honored teachers of Russia worked in school: N. N. Zhuravlev, L. D. Korotaeva, M. G. Kolomytsky, N. V. Zagrebaylova.
The school museum operates and it was recognized as one of the best in the region. It was headed up to 2000 year by history teacher Yu.N. Golovanenko.
